Classify the equation 6x+4x-1=2(5x+4) as having one​ solution, infinitely many​ solutions, or no solution.

Respuesta :

realnicklepickle25
realnicklepickle25 realnicklepickle25
  • 23-10-2020

Answer:

No Solution

Step-by-step explanation:

6x+4x-1=2(5x+4)

10x-1=10x+8

-1=+8
